The Rise of Digital Payments in Everyday Life
A Shift Driven by Simplicity
Cash transactions involve counting money, waiting for change, and managing physical storage. A UPI App removes these obstacles by enabling instant transfers directly between bank accounts. Users no longer need to carry cash or worry about exact denominations, making digital payments more practical for everyday use.
This simplicity has encouraged people across different age groups to adopt digital payment methods. Whether paying utility bills, splitting expenses, or making retail purchases, digital transactions have become faster and easier than traditional cash handling.
Growing Trust in Digital Systems
Initially, many users were hesitant to move away from cash due to security concerns. Over time, strong authentication processes and real-time transaction alerts have increased confidence in digital payments. As trust has grown, users have become more comfortable using digital platforms for both small and large transactions.

Advantages of Using a UPI App Over Cash
Speed and Convenience
Cash transactions can be time-consuming, especially during busy hours. A UPI App enables instant payments, reducing wait times and improving overall efficiency. This speed is particularly useful in environments where quick transactions are essential.
Improved Record Keeping
Every digital transaction creates a record, making it easier to track expenses and manage budgets. Unlike cash, which leaves no trail, digital payments provide clarity and transparency. This organized financial behavior can be beneficial when planning future expenses or exploring loan options.
Reduced Dependency on Physical Currency
Handling cash involves risks such as loss, theft, or damage. Digital payments minimize these risks by keeping money securely within the banking system. As more people recognize these benefits, reliance on physical currency continues to decline.

Challenges and Adaptation
Addressing Digital Literacy
Despite widespread adoption, some users still face challenges due to limited digital literacy. Continuous efforts in education and awareness are necessary to ensure everyone can benefit from digital payment systems. As understanding improves, more people are expected to transition away from cash.
Infrastructure and Connectivity
Reliable internet access is essential for digital payments. While connectivity has improved significantly, ongoing development is needed to ensure consistent access across all regions. As infrastructure strengthens, digital payments will become even more reliable.
The Future of Payments in India
A Gradual Move Toward a Cash-Light Economy
India is not eliminating cash entirely, but the role of physical currency is steadily decreasing. A UPI App supports a cash-light economy where digital transactions dominate daily activities. This shift allows for better transparency and efficiency across the financial system.
